FDA Grants Breakthrough Therapy Designation to Olomorasib for KRAS G12C-Mutant Advanced Pancreatic Cancer

On August 3, 2026, Eli Lilly and Company announced that the US Food and Drug Administration (FDA) had granted Breakthrough Therapy designation to olomorasib as monotherapy for adults with advanced pancreatic cancer who have received at least one prior systemic therapy and whose tumours harbour a KRAS G12C mutation, as determined by an FDA-approved test.

The designation is intended to expedite the development and review of therapies for serious conditions when preliminary clinical evidence indicates that a treatment may provide substantial improvement over available therapies on a clinically significant endpoint. It also provides more intensive FDA guidance during development and may accelerate the path toward regulatory approval.

What is Olomorasib?

Olomorasib, also known as LY3537982, is an investigational, oral, potent and highly selective next-generation inhibitor of the KRAS G12C protein. It was designed to target KRAS G12C-mutant cancers and has pharmacokinetic properties intended to support high predicted target occupancy and potency when administered alone or in combination with other treatments.

Lilly has described olomorasib as a highly potent covalent inhibitor of KRAS G12C. The agent has pharmacokinetic properties that allow for high predicted target occupancy and high potency when used as monotherapy or in combination with other treatments.

Olomorasib is being evaluated as monotherapy and in combination with other treatments across KRAS G12C-mutant advanced solid tumours. Its clinical development programme includes the phase 1/2 LOXO-RAS-20001 study, as well as studies combining olomorasib with pembrolizumab, chemotherapy or standard-of-care immunotherapy in different settings of KRAS G12C-mutant non-small cell lung cancer.

Supporting Evidence From LOXO-RAS-20001

The Breakthrough Therapy designation was based on encouraging preliminary findings from LOXO-RAS-20001, an open-label, multicentre phase 1/2 study evaluating LY3537982 in patients with KRAS G12C-mutant advanced solid tumours. The study includes patients with advanced pancreatic cancer who have received at least one previous systemic therapy.

LOXO-RAS-20001, also identified as NCT04956640, is evaluating the safety, tolerability and preliminary efficacy of olomorasib. It includes a phase 1a dose-escalation component evaluating olomorasib monotherapy and a phase 1b dose-expansion and optimisation component evaluating the agent alone and in combination with other treatments. Detailed efficacy and safety results supporting the designation were not reported in the announcement.

KRAS G12C-Mutant Pancreatic Cancer

KRAS mutations are found in approximately 90% of pancreatic cancers, while the KRAS G12C variant occurs in approximately 1%–2% of patients with the disease.

According to Lilly, outcomes for patients with metastatic pancreatic cancer remain poor, with a five-year survival rate below 5%. The company also stated that growing evidence suggests that patients with KRAS G12C-mutant pancreatic cancer may have worse outcomes than patients without the mutation.

There are currently no approved therapies specifically targeting KRAS G12C-mutant pancreatic cancer.

Jacob Van Naarden, executive vice president and president of Lilly Oncology, said:

“Pancreatic cancer has historically been one of the most difficult-to-treat cancers and people whose tumors harbor a KRAS G12C mutation face limited options once their disease progresses.”

Previous FDA Breakthrough Therapy Designation

The pancreatic cancer designation is the second FDA Breakthrough Therapy designation granted to olomorasib.

In September 2025, the FDA granted Breakthrough Therapy designation to olomorasib in combination with pembrolizumab for the first-line treatment of patients with unresectable or metastatic KRAS G12C-mutant non-small cell lung cancer whose tumours have PD-L1 expression of at least 50%, as determined by FDA-approved tests.

Breakthrough Therapy designation is intended to expedite the development and review of investigational therapies. It does not constitute FDA approval.

SUNRAY-01 and SUNRAY-02

LY3537982 is also being investigated in two global studies involving patients with KRAS G12C-mutant non-small cell lung cancer.

SUNRAY-01, identified as NCT06119581, is a pivotal, registrational study evaluating olomorasib in combination with pembrolizumab, with or without chemotherapy, as first-line treatment for advanced KRAS G12C-mutant non-small cell lung cancer.

SUNRAY-02, identified as NCT06890598, is evaluating olomorasib in combination with standard-of-care immunotherapy in patients with resected or unresectable KRAS G12C-mutant non-small cell lung cancer.
